Fishing in Lake Sammamish
Lake Sammamish is a beautiful freshwater lake located in Washington state, offering excellent fishing opportunities throughout the year. The lake is home to various fish species including largemouth bass, smallmouth bass, yellow perch, and cutthroat trout.Anglers can enjoy both shore fishing and boat fishing on this 8-mile long lake. The best fishing seasons are spring and fall when water temperatures are ideal for fish activity. Popular fishing techniques include trolling, casting, and fly fishing.
The lake features several public access points and parks with fishing piers, making it accessible to anglers of all experience levels. Always check Washington Department of Fish and Wildlife regulations for current fishing rules and license requirements before your trip.
